Weather in April

April, the same as March, is another warm spring month in Kot Najibullah, Pakistan, with temperature in the range of an average high of 29.3°C (84.7°F) and an average low of 16°C (60.8°F).

Temperature

April's arrival coincides with a rise in the average high-temperature, moving from March's 23.4°C (74.1°F) to a still warm 29.3°C (84.7°F). April nights bring a significant cooling from the heat of the day, with averages of 16°C (60.8°F).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in April in Kot Najibullah is 40%.

Rainfall

In Kot Najibullah, Pakistan, in April, during 12.4 rainfall days, 46mm (1.81")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Kot Najibullah, during the entire year, the rain falls for 111.1 days and collects up to 564mm (22.2")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Kot Najibullah, Pakistan, the average length of the day in April is 13h and 2min.
On the first day of April, sunrise is at 5:55 am and sunset at 6:29 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:20 am and sunset at 6:51 pm PKT.

Sunshine

In Kot Najibullah, the average sunshine in April is 11.5h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in April in Kot Najibullah is 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.

Average temperature in April - Kot Najibullah, Pakistan
Average temperature in April
Kot Najibullah, Pakistan
  • Average high temperature in April: 29.3°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is June (37.9°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(16.4°C).

  • Average low temperature in April: 16°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is July (26.3°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(6.3°C).
